#85213C Hex Color Code

#85213C

The Hexadecimal Color #85213C is a contrast shade of Brown. #85213C RGB value is rgb(133, 33, 60). RGB Color Model of #85213C consists of 52% red, 12% green and 23% blue. HSL color Mode of #85213C has 344°(degrees) Hue, 60% Saturation and 33% Lightness. #85213C color has an wavelength of 403.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#85213C is #993366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#85213C is #824. The Closest Color to #85213C is #A52A2A. Official Name of #85213C Hex Code is Lotus.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#85213C is 0 Cyan 75 Magenta 55 Yellow 48 Black and #85213C CMY is 0, 75, 55.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#85213C is hsl(344,60,33,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(344, 75, 52).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#85213C is 11.03, 6.4, 4.93.
Hex8 Value of #85213C is #85213CFF. Decimal Value of #85213C is 8724796 and Octal Value of #85213C is 41220474. Binary Value of #85213C is 10000101, 100001, 111100 and Android of #85213C is 4286914876 / 0xff85213c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#85213C is 0.493, 0.286, 0.286 and YIQ Color Space of #85213C is 65.978, 50.9149, 29.5524.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#85213C is 10.03, 3.13, 4.97.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#85213C is 30.4, 43.88, 8.72.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#85213C is 30.4, 64.95, 1.77.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#85213C is 30.4, 44.74, 11.24. Hunter Lab variable of #85213C is 25.3, 33.55, 6.15.

Various Color Shades of #85213C

To get 25% Saturated #85213C Color, you need to convert the hex color #85213C to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#85213C h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#85213C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
